Jacques Frémontier

Summary

Jacques Frémontier is a human[1]. His place of birth was 18th arrondissement of Paris[2]. He was born on +1930-05-08T00:00:00Z[3]. He died in 14th arrondissement of Paris[4]. He died on +2020-04-07T00:00:00Z[5]. He worked as a historian[6], sociologist[7], journalist[8], and television producer[9].
